Last week I posted on the WWL story of a contractor stuffing the joints of a NOLA floodwall with newspaper instead of rubber. I followed with another post called "I Iz Contractr."
However given new information that post should have rightly been titled "I Iz ACE." (Army Corps of Engineers).
Via Jeffrey is this from the Times Picayune:
Corps officials said it used its own hired workers in 2006 to put in the newspaper filling, not a contractor.
